Once you submit your completed OPT application online, you will be issued an application
receipt number and will be able to access your application receipt notice through your MyUSCIS
account.
If OPT is approved, your EAD card will be mailed to the U.S. mailing address provided on your I-
765 Form.

Students can file their application online or by mail. DHS recommends online filing. Here are some of the
benefits of filing online:

USCIS receives online forms faster than paper
forms
Receive receipt notice of your application
immediately
Receive USCIS notices online, and sign up for
email/text notifications
Track and review your application after
submission
Pay fees online
Respond to requests for evidence online
Send USCIS secure messages about your case
Easy access to all USCIS correspondence
Upload additional documentation to
application after submission
Update your mailing and physical address
